Well, I haven't taken the DATs yet. But from what I remember, the main thing is base peak is usually the tallest peak and M+ is the molecular formula of the compound.

Cl 35 and Cl 37 are in a 3:1 ratio, Br 79 and Br 81 are in a 51:49 ratio, Nitrogen will make the M+ odd, but if there are an even number of nitrogens, it will be even. The M+1 peak can be due to the isotope C13 which is only 1.1%. Oxygen cannot be found in mass spec!

I think those are the main points! And if you just remember these few things, you should be good. Good luck!
